šæ 1. Become Aware of Your Inner Voice
Your mindset starts with your thoughts.
Pay attention to how you speak to yourself.
Is it kind? Or critical?
Instead of:
āI canāt cope.ā
Try:
āThis is hard, but I am capable.ā
Awareness is the first step to change.
You canāt shift what you donāt notice.
⨠Ask yourself daily: Would I speak to someone I love the way I speak to myself?
š· 2. Take Responsibility (Without Blame)
This is empowering, not punishing.
You may not control everything that happens to youā¦
But you do control how you respond.
When you stop waiting for circumstances to change and start choosing your reactions, everything shifts.
Responsibility = Personal power.
š¼ 3. Practice Gratitude Daily
Gratitude rewires your brain.
Science supports that focusing on whatās going well strengthens positive neural pathways. Over time, your mind starts looking for the good automatically.
Start small:
A warm cup of tea ā
A quiet moment
Your childrenās laughter
A safe home
Gratitude doesnāt ignore pain.
It simply refuses to let pain be the only focus.

šŗ 5. Take Small Brave Actions
Mindset doesnāt change through thinking alone.
It changes through action.
You build confidence by doing the thing ā scared but willing.
Small actions create evidence:
Sending the message
Starting the walk
Posting the idea
Setting the boundary
Every tiny step tells your brain:
āI can.ā
And eventually, you believe it.
